[rawfeeding] Update on our one month progress on a raw diet

Hello everyone. This post is sort of long but it's because we are so happy with the results we are seeing with our dogs. We have two English Bulldogs, a female and male, and they weigh 56 and 58 pounds, in that order. We have had them on a raw diet for approximately one month and the changes we have noticed have been remarkable. Their coats are so much softer. It reminds us of puppy fur. It is much more luxurious to the touch. We want to pet and rub and massage them even more now and somehow they don't object to it at all. It amounts to extra attention and what dog doesn't like that? We've also noticed that they are much happier and more playful. They play tug-of-war with each other, something they didn't do in the past. They appear to have a lot more energy. They used to sleep all the time and we thought that's what bulldogs do. Five minutes of activity and it was nap time. Now, they want to go for walkies. Our male has hip dysplasia. It was always painful for him to go
for a walk. He would walk very slowly and deliberately. After a short distance, maybe 50 yards or so, we come back home and it's time for a nap. We really don't know, nor can we appreciate the amount of pain he was in just to do that small amount of activity. He also had a cyst on his inner thigh that would grow and the vet would have to drain it almost monthly. After a short romp in the doggie pool or chasing a few soap bubbles in the backyard, he was in pain and limping for a day. Our hearts went out to him, but you have to allow him to be a dog and do doggie stuff, right? We didn't feel we were being cruel but we still felt responsible for his pain. Well, no more of that. Now, he walks better and faster. The cyst has disappeared completely. Needless to say, we are so pleased thus far and we are very grateful to learn about this diet.
